TOP10 is a GNU/Linux-based Go-Kart simulator software.
One of the highlights of TOP10 is its stunning 3D graphics, which are powered by OpenGL (note that a 3D accelerator is required). You can choose to play in single-player mode and race against the clock, or simply enjoy the stereo sounds and watch replays of previous races.
If you're feeling creative, you can even use TOP10's track editor to design your own race courses. And with support for multiple input devices (keyboard, joystick, driving wheel, and joypad), you can find the control method that works best for you.
To run TOP10, you'll need a number of dependencies, including SDL 1.2, SDL_image 1.2.0, PLIB 1.8.3, lib3ds1.2.0, OpenGL and GLU, gcc 3.3.4 (or later), and automake 1.7 (or later).
The latest version of TOP10 comes with some exciting updates, including a brand new track editor using Qt and two additional tracks (Laval and MaisonBlanche). If you're a fan of Go-Kart racing, TOP10 is definitely worth a look.
